Mec1 [ATR (ataxia telangiectasia mutated- and Rad3-related) in humans] is the principle kinase responsible for checkpoint activation in response to replication stress and DNA damage in Saccharomyces cerevisiae. Investigation of the mechanism of uptake of melphalan by L5178Y lymphoblasts has been extended with particular emphasis on the chemical specificity of the transport mech anism. Evidence was obtained that uptake of melphalan was an active carrier-mediated process. The tsunami source of the 2016 Fukushima Earthquake, which was generated by a normal faulting earthquake mech‐ anism, is estimated by inverting the tsunami waveforms that were recorded by seven tide gauge stations and two wave gauge stations along the north Pacific coast of Japan.
